Description

Seneciphylline n-Oxide is a pyrrolizidine alkaloid derivative, specifically the N-oxide form of seneciphylline, known for its role as a reference standard and a key compound in phytochemical research. Its significance lies in its utility for the accurate identification, quantification, and toxicological study of pyrrolizidine alkaloids in plant materials and herbal products. This high-purity compound is essential for researchers and quality control laboratories in the pharmaceutical, nutraceutical, and botanical extract industries who require reliable analytical standards to ensure product safety and regulatory compliance.

Application

  • Analytical Reference Standard: Primary use as a certified reference material (CRM) for HPLC, LC-MS, and GC-MS analysis in laboratory settings.
  • Phytochemical Research: Used in the isolation, characterization, and metabolic pathway studies of pyrrolizidine alkaloids.
  • Toxicology and Safety Assessment: Critical for calibrating equipment and developing methods to detect and quantify potentially hepatotoxic pyrrolizidine alkaloid contaminants in food, feed, and herbal supplements.
  • Method Development and Validation: Serves as a benchmark compound for establishing and validating new analytical protocols in compliance with pharmacopeial guidelines (e.g., USP, EP).
  • Quality Control in Manufacturing: Employed by manufacturers of botanical extracts to test for the presence and levels of specific alkaloids, ensuring batch-to-batch consistency and purity.
  • Academic and Institutional Research: Used in university and government labs for studies on plant biochemistry, natural product chemistry, and the biosynthetic origins of alkaloids.

Basic Information

Product Name Seneciphylline n-Oxide
CAS No. 38710-26-8
Molecular Formula C18H23NO6
Molecular Weight 349.38 g/mol
Synonyms Seneciphylline N-Oxide; 12,13-Didehydro-9,10-dehydrosenecionan-11,16-dione, 19-methyl-, 1-oxide; (13Z)-Senecionan-11,16-dione, 19-methyl-, 1-oxide; Seneciphylline 1-oxide; Seneciphylline oxide; Jacobine N-oxide (related isomer); PA N-oxide standard
